Détails pour Application Performance Monitoring
Décrit les détails de journalisation pour Application Performance Monitoring (APM).
Ressources
- Domaines API
Catégories de journaux
Valeur d'API (ID) : | Console (Nom d'affichage) | Description |
---|---|---|
données supprimées | Données supprimées | Demandes d'ingestion entrantes rejetées par le service APM en raison de la limitation, de clés de données non valides ou de données utiles surdimensionnées ou mal formées. Ces informations aident les clients à trier les demandes abandonnées. |
Disponibilité
La journalisation d'Application Performance Monitoring est disponible dans toutes les régions des domaines commerciaux.
Commentaires
Les journaux de service pour la journalisation d'Application Performance Monitoring sont fournis avec le meilleur effort. Dans des situations limitées, quelques entrées de journal peuvent ne pas être livrées avec succès. En outre, le nombre de messages de journal par minute est limité.
Contenu d'un journal Application Performance Monitoring
Propriété | Description |
---|---|
heure d'arrivée | Horodatage à l'arrivée de l'observation, au format "2023-03-14T15 :21 :27.010Z". |
contenu | Contenu initial de l'observation. La taille limite d'affichage est de 4 Ko. |
longueur du contenu | Longueur du contenu en octets. |
format de données | Nom de format des données, par exemple "apm". |
versionde données | Format de version. |
message | Chaîne lisible par l'homme décrivant la cause du rejet. |
obstype | Type de l'observation, par exemple "public-span". |
clause de rejet | Cause du rejet, qui peut être l'une des suivantes :
|
compartmentid | OCID du compartiment. |
loggroupid | OCID du groupe de journaux. |
logid | OCID de l'objet de journal. |
tenantid | OCID du locataire. |
id | UUID du message du journal. |
source | OCID du domaine APM. |
specversion | Version de la spécification CloudEvents utilisée par l'événement. Cela permet d'interpréter le contexte. |
time | Horodatage de l'écriture du journal. |
type | Type de message. Les consommateurs utilisent type et specversion pour déterminer comment interpréter le corps. Modèle : com.oraclecloud.{service}.{resource-type}.{category} , par exemple com.oraclecloud.compute.instance.terminated . |
Exemple de journal Application Performance Monitoring
{
"datetime": 1678807287324,
"logContent": {
"data": {
"arrivaltime": "2023-03-14T15:21:27.010Z",
"content": "{\\\"major-version\\\": 1, \\\"minor-version\\\": 0, \\\"payload-creation-ts-millis\\\": 1678807286000, \\\"resource\\\": {\\\"attributes\\\": [{\\\"key\\\": \\\"Component\\\", \\\"value\\\": \\\"BROWSER\\\"}, {\\\"key\\\": \\\"ServiceName\\\", \\\"value\\\": \\\"dogService\\\"}, {\\\"key\\\": \\\"ApmrumLanguage\\\", \\\"value\\\": \\\"en-US\\\"}, {\\\"key\\\": \\\"ApmrumWindowId\\\", \\\"value\\\": \\\"\\\"}, {\\\"key\\\": \\\"SessionId\\\", \\\"value\\\": \\\"session-dog1678807286000-3311688\\\"}, {\\\"key\\\": \\\"UserName\\\", \\\"value\\\": \\\"dogUser\\\"}]}, \\\"spans\\\": [{\\\"id\\\": \\\"dog1678807286000-3311688-2929311\\\", \\\"trace-id\\\": \\\"dog1678807286000-3311688\\\", \\\"name\\\": \\\"Page Load dogPage\\\", \\\"ts-micros\\\": 1678807284900000, \\\"td-micros\\\": 820619, \\\"kind\\\": \\\"PRODUCER\\\", \\\"attributes\\\": {\\\"ApmrumType\\\": \\\"Page\\\", \\\"WebApplicationName\\\": \\\"dogWebapp\\\", \\\"PageInitTime\\\": 870, \\\"PageFirstByteTime\\\": 412, \\\"PageDownloadTime\\\": 17, \\\"PageRenderTime\\\": 994, \\\"PageInteractiveTime\\\": 341, \\\"ApmrumPageUpdateType\\\": \\\"Page Load\\\", \\\"HttpUrl\\\": \\\"http://www.dogHost.com/dogIndex.html\\\", \\\"HttpUrlHost\\\": \\\"http://www.dogHost.com\\\", \\\"HttpUrlPath\\\": \\\"/dogIndex.html\\\", \\\"HttpStatusCode\\\": 200, \\\"Error\\\": false}, \\\"links\\\": []}, {\\\"id\\\": 5797336, \\\"trace-id\\\": \\\"dog1678807286000-3311688\\\", \\\"parent-id\\\": \\\"dog1678807286000-3311688-2929311\\\", \\\"name\\\": \\\"Page Load page-0\\\", \\\"ts-micros\\\": 1678807284900000, \\\"td-micros\\\": 990000, \\\"kind\\\": \\\"PRODUCER\\\", \\\"attributes\\\": {\\\"ApmrumType\\\": \\\"Page\\\", \\\"WebApplicationName\\\": \\\"dogWebapp\\\", \\\"PageInitTime\\\": 110, \\\"PageFirstByteTime\\\": 304, \\\"PageDownloadTime\\\": 5, \\\"PageRenderTime\\\": 732, \\\"PageInteractiveTime\\\": 401, \\\"ApmrumPageUpdateType\\\": \\\"Page Load\\\", \\\"HttpUrl\\\": \\\"http://www.dogHost.com/dogIndex.html\\\", \\\"HttpUrlHost\\\": \\\"http://www.dogHost.com\\\", \\\"HttpUrlPath\\\": \\\"/dogIndex.html\\\", \\\"HttpStatusCode\\\": 200, \\\"Error\\\": false}, \\\"links\\\": []}]}",
"contentlength": "1616",
"dataformat": "apm",
"dataformatversion": "1",
"message": "The request is rejected due to throttling limits.",
"obstype": "public-span",
"rejectioncause": "PAYLOAD_THROTTLED"
},
"id": "<unique_ID>",
"oracle": {
"compartmentid": "ocid1.compartment.oc1..<unique_ID>",
"ingestedtime": "2023-03-14T15:21:35.427Z",
"loggroupid": "ocid1.loggroup.oc1.phx.<unique_ID>",
"logid": "ocid1.log.oc1.phx.<unique_ID>",
"tenantid": "ocid1.tenancy.oc1..<unique_ID>"
},
"source": "ocid1.apmdomain.oc1.phx.<unique_ID>",
"specversion": "1.0",
"time": "2023-03-14T15:21:27.324Z",
"type": "com.oraclecloud.apm.domain.dropped-data"
}
}